Amsterdam-born football legend Ruud Gullit, who entered the world on September 1, 1962, is celebrated as one of the finest players in football history. Known for his versatility on the field, commanding presence, and unique playing style, Gullit left an enduring impact on football at every level.
Growing up in the bustling neighborhoods of Amsterdam, Gullit found his love for football early on. His professional journey kicked off with HFC Haarlem, and he soon made a significant move to Feyenoord, a top Dutch club. It was at Feyenoord that Gullit truly began to demonstrate his multi-dimensional talents, gaining recognition for his ability to excel in any role on the field.
The transfer to AC Milan in 1985 was a defining chapter for Gullit, propelling him onto the global stage. Under the guidance of coach Arrigo Sacchi, Gullit became a key figure in Milan’s tactical revolution, blending technical skill with strategic intelligence. The synergy between Gullit, van Basten, and Rijkaard at Milan became a defining element of the club’s success, creating an era of unmatched dominance.
Representing the Netherlands, Gullit was equally influential on the international stage. The 1988 European Championship highlighted Gullit’s abilities, as he not only scored decisive goals but also embodied the leadership that inspired his teammates. Gullit’s ability to seamlessly adapt to different roles on the field made him unpredictable and invaluable.
Beyond his on-field brilliance, Gullit was recognized for his charisma and presence, both on and off the pitch. The dreadlocks he famously wore were more than a style statement—they represented a new era of self-expression in football. Moreover, he was a vocal advocate for racial equality and social justice, using his platform to challenge prejudice in football.
Gullit’s post-playing career saw him take on managerial responsibilities, applying his experience and vision to developing teams. He managed several clubs, including Chelsea in the English Premier League, where he became one of the first high-profile foreign managers in England.
